Career path

Career Role Description
Project Manager Responsible for planning, executing, and closing projects within budget and timeline.
Team Leader Leads a team of individuals towards achieving project goals and objectives.
Collaboration Specialist Facilitates communication and collaboration among team members to enhance productivity.
Project Coordinator Coordinates project activities, resources, and stakeholders to ensure successful project completion.
Scrum Master Facilitates Agile project management processes and practices within a team.
